American devices maker Apple is preparing to enter the segment of foldable smartphones. This smartphone of the company can be called iPhone Fold or iPhone Ultra. This foldable iPhone can also be introduced with Apple’s iPhone series to be launched this year. The market of foldable smartphones has grown rapidly in the last few years.
An article on China’s microblogging platform Weibo Post Tipster Fixed Focus Digital has reported that 3D printed technology can be used for the hinge of the foldable iPhone. This will minimize the crease on the display of iPhone Fold. Earlier the company has used 3D printed case for Apple Watch. Apart from this, the USB Type-C port of iPhone Air is also made with this technology.
Recently, Chinese smartphone maker Oppo used 3D printed polymer to fill the space below the crease in its new foldable smartphone. The company had said that the crease on the display of Oppo Find N6 appears almost ‘zero’. Dual-layer UTG and UFG glass design can be found in iPhone Fold. In this, the display of this smartphone will be between two thin sheets of glass. An updated hinge design may also be seen in the foldable iPhone. With this, this smartphone can be folded easily and there will be very less creases visible on its display.
The company’s upcoming processor built on 2 nm process can be given in iPhone Fold. Recently it was reported in a media report that Apple Samsung Display can order around 20 million panels for its foldable iPhone. This is indicating strong demand forecast for foldable iPhone. Manufacturing of display for this smartphone can be started in May. The inner screen of iPhone Fold can be 7.58 inches and the outer display can be 5.25 inches. The user interface of this smartphone may look similar to iPad when unfolded. On opening this smartphone, two apps will be able to run side by side simultaneously on its display. In current iPhones, users cannot run two apps simultaneously on the display.
